Output 024efbee60ce8b00fa7c98f29a5cd18615e6bd33cb7d8e2e0bc06dca4f62a0d2:2

value
969948440
script pubkey
OP_0 OP_PUSHBYTES_20 640393dfeac557a6311ecfc8bf71e391c54d825a
address
bc1qvspe8hl2c4t6vvg7elyt7u0rj8z5mqj6raqrzu
transaction
024efbee60ce8b00fa7c98f29a5cd18615e6bd33cb7d8e2e0bc06dca4f62a0d2
confirmations
375269
spent
true